## Who to ping about GiftNote

Welcome aboard! GiftNote is our donation-receipt mailer for the Larchfield Fund. Template tweaks go to the comms folks; delivery failures and bounce weirdness go to the platform crew. Don't push template changes on Fridays — receipts batch over the weekend. For anything GiftNote-related, start with the address below.

billing contact of kaweg-tajeg = drudor.lamion.oliath@torvalabs.test

**Finance Review Summary — Inventory Write-down**

Welcome aboard. Short version: we took a 1.4m write-down on the Duskwell accessory line last quarter — overbought ahead of a launch that slipped twice. Warehouse counts are now monthly instead of quarterly, and purchasing approvals above 100k need two signatures. The hit is fully booked; no further surprises expected. How this shapes next year's plan is noted below.

internal memo for kawip-hadug: Headcount on the Wenwyn team goes from 7 to 140 by the end of January. Gross margin on Wenwyn came in at 20 percent against a plan of 15 percent.

### Sending receipts via GiveSprig

Plugin authors: to trigger a donation receipt, POST the donation payload to the GiveSprig mailer endpoint and we'll handle templating and delivery. Sandbox mode echoes the rendered email back instead of sending it. Every request needs an auth header, and the shared sandbox key is shown below.

gateway credential: kto23_LX9A4ys6i4nzHtpOLNLodKK